🔑 Key Takeaways

  • Every situation has a good side and a bad side. You choose which side you focus on.

  • A painful financial mistake today can be your superpower tomorrow—if you learn the lesson.

  • Traumatic investment losses often create smarter, stronger, more diligent investors.

  • Investing is risky, but not every risk is worth taking. Due diligence is non-negotiable.

  • Pre-build property deals carry hidden risks—your capital is tied up, the property isn’t yours yet, and external factors (like hurricanes or legislative delays) can derail everything.

✅ Actionable Insights:

  1. Flip the coin.
    Whenever you're stuck in disappointment, ask yourself: What's the good in this? What did this teach me?

  2. Set boundaries with your generosity.
    Helping loved ones? Get clear on your terms. Protect your credit and your peace.

  3. Pre-build investments? Proceed with caution.
    Understand what you don’t control — and always plan for delays and disruption.

  4. Write your lessons down.
    Seriously — keep an “Investor’s Journal.” Catalog what went right, what went wrong, and what you’ll do differently.

  5. Hold the vision.
    When fear tells you to run, remind yourself why you started. Your dream life is still on the other side.
